Output ebc35dca27d44e2255a0bc0ac281fdb0599cc92d1a38ee5b334c1e3673aa7484:31

value
687274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15d04f18aef710159759530a4002f289594e6f5 OP_EQUAL
address
3KKRmfMLWYGzNtNW9BCq9Kx3am8ab6asxf
transaction
ebc35dca27d44e2255a0bc0ac281fdb0599cc92d1a38ee5b334c1e3673aa7484
confirmations
125880
spent
true